diff options
author | nbm <nbm@FreeBSD.org> | 2000-10-14 09:29:49 +0800 |
---|---|---|
committer | nbm <nbm@FreeBSD.org> | 2000-10-14 09:29:49 +0800 |
commit | 3a1a206d6930b26eb09b052001e501eafbfeb0ab (patch) | |
tree | 02c4ed9f1e7e32477b574487fbfb73acd8ed7c3a /mail/vpopmail-stable | |
parent | 244f496b5802e7401bec6ea47e5216bf3a397d2e (diff) | |
download | freebsd-ports-gnome-3a1a206d6930b26eb09b052001e501eafbfeb0ab.tar.gz freebsd-ports-gnome-3a1a206d6930b26eb09b052001e501eafbfeb0ab.tar.zst freebsd-ports-gnome-3a1a206d6930b26eb09b052001e501eafbfeb0ab.zip |
Upgrade to 4.9.4.
This changes a default - you now need to specify WITH_PASSWD to
authenticate against /etc/passwd. This means the vchkpw needn't run as
root.
Diffstat (limited to 'mail/vpopmail-stable')
-rw-r--r-- | mail/vpopmail-stable/Makefile | 55 | ||||
-rw-r--r-- | mail/vpopmail-stable/distinfo | 2 |
2 files changed, 53 insertions, 4 deletions
diff --git a/mail/vpopmail-stable/Makefile b/mail/vpopmail-stable/Makefile index 4b854b9e14db..67233aeb3ec6 100644 --- a/mail/vpopmail-stable/Makefile +++ b/mail/vpopmail-stable/Makefile @@ -6,7 +6,7 @@ # PORTNAME= vpopmail -PORTVERSION= 4.9 +PORTVERSION= 4.9.4 CATEGORIES= mail MASTER_SITES= http://www.inter7.com/vpopmail/ @@ -25,9 +25,29 @@ CONFIGURE_ARGS= --enable-qmail-dir=${QMAIL_DIR} \ --enable-tcpserver-file=${PREFIX}/vpopmail/etc/tcp.smtp # -# Attempt to set the location of qmail by a simple check. Override this -# if your qmail lives elsewhere. +# User-configurable variables # +# Define these to change from the default behaviour +# +# WITH_PASSWD - allow authentication off /etc/passwd +# WITH_APOP - allow apop authentication +# WITHOUT_ROAMING - disallow roaming users +# +# Set these to the values you'd prefer +# +# HARDQUOTA - size of hard quota, or 'n' for no hard quota +# RELAYCLEAR - time in minutes before clearing relay hole (requires roaming) +# LOGLEVEL - n - no logging, y - log all, +# e - log errors, p - log passwords in errors +# APOPFILE - location of apop secrets file +# QMAIL_DIR - location of qmail directory +# PREFIX - installation area for vpopmail (see comment below) +# + +HARDQUOTA?= 10000000 +RELAYCLEAR?= 30 +LOGLEVEL?= y +APOPFILE?= /etc/apop-secrets .if exists(${LOCALBASE}/qmail/bin/qmail-send) QMAIL_DIR?= ${LOCALBASE}/qmail @@ -35,6 +55,35 @@ QMAIL_DIR?= ${LOCALBASE}/qmail QMAIL_DIR?= /var/qmail .endif +# Uncomment this, or set PREFIX to /home if you have an existing +# vpopmail install with the vpopmail users' home directory set to +# /home/vpopmail - package rules dictate we default to /usr/local/vpopmail +# +#PREFIX?= /home + +# End of user-configurable variables + +# +# Some suggestions from Gabriel Ambuehl <gabriel_ambuehl@buz.ch> +# + +CONFIGURE_ARGS+= --enable-hardquota=${HARDQUOTA} \ + --enable-logging=${LOGLEVEL} + +.if !defined(WITH_PASSWD) +CONFIGURE_ARGS+= --enable-passwd=n +.endif + +.if defined(WITH_APOP) +CONFIGURE_ARGS+= --enable-apop=y \ + --enable-apop-file=${APOPFILE} +.endif + +.if !defined(WITHOUT_ROAMING) +CONFIGURE_ARGS+= --enable-roaming-users=y \ + --enable-relay-clear-minutes=${RELAYCLEAR} +.endif + # # This port doesn't honour PREFIX, it honours vpopmail's home directory. # Since we create vpopmail if it doesn't exist, we set it so that it diff --git a/mail/vpopmail-stable/distinfo b/mail/vpopmail-stable/distinfo index cd3c85023f67..a122ec2e667d 100644 --- a/mail/vpopmail-stable/distinfo +++ b/mail/vpopmail-stable/distinfo @@ -1 +1 @@ -MD5 (vpopmail-4.9.tar.gz) = 2b9d71ea69cbeacedce9654fc439ee19 +MD5 (vpopmail-4.9.4.tar.gz) = 7bac93ecd0641eb8c991c081a4cfd08e |